Navigating the Moral Maze of AI
Artificial intelligence is rapidly evolving, altering industries and societies at an unprecedented pace. This growth of AI presents a myriad of ethical concerns, demanding careful scrutiny. One important aspect is the potential of bias in AI algorithms, which can perpetuate and amplify existing disparities within our communities. Furthermore, the explainability of AI decision-making processes remains a ongoing conversation, as it is essential to ensure accountability and confidence in these systems.
Another key ethical matter is the impact of AI on data protection. As AI systems increasingly gather vast amounts of data, it is imperative to establish robust safeguards to preserve individual rights. Moreover, the displacement of human jobs by AI raises questions about the future of work and the obligation for reskilling and upskilling initiatives.
Addressing these ethical challenges requires a multifaceted approach involving partnership among researchers, policymakers, industry leaders, and the general population. Open discussion, openness in AI development, and a strong commitment to ethical values are fundamental for ensuring that artificial intelligence is used for the benefit of humanity.

{Here are some examples of machine learning's impact on various industries:
- Medicine: Machine learning is used to identify diseases, personalize treatment plans, and expedite drug discovery.
- Economics: Machine learning algorithms are employed for credit scoring and financial forecasting.
- Industry: Machine learning is used to improve production processes, predictequipment failures, and minimize costs.
